Kundada Population - East Godavari, Andhra Pradesh
Kundada is a medium size village located in Maredumilli Mandal of East Godavari district, Andhra Pradesh with total 128 families residing. The Kundada village has population of 497 of which 288 are males while 209 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Kundada village population of children with age 0-6 is 78 which makes up 15.69 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kundada village is 726 which is lower than Andhra Pradesh state average of 993. Child Sex Ratio for the Kundada as per census is 902, lower than Andhra Pradesh average of 939.
Kundada village has higher literacy rate compared to Andhra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Kundada village was 70.88 % compared to 67.02 % of Andhra Pradesh. In Kundada Male literacy stands at 81.78 % while female literacy rate was 55.23 %.

Kundada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 128 | - | - |
Population | 497 | 288 | 209 |
Child (0-6) | 78 | 41 | 37 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 497 | 288 | 209 |
Literacy | 70.88 % | 81.78 % | 55.23 % |
Total Workers | 370 | 197 | 173 |
Main Worker | 333 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 37 | 14 | 23 |
